The overview below groups typical Azalea Pruning proj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Mason County, WA.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Basic Azalea Pruning - Typically costs between $50 and $150 for small to medium-sized bushes. This includes removing dead or overgrown branches to promote healthy growth.
Mid-Range Azalea Pruning - Usually ranges from $150 to $300 for larger or more complex trimming jobs. Service providers may also shape the shrub for aesthetic purposes.
Heavy or Overgrown Azalea Pruning - Can cost $300 or more, especially for extensive pruning of multiple or large bushes. This may involve significant branch removal to rejuvenate the plant.
Seasonal or Maintenance Pruning - Often priced around $75 to $200 per session, depending on the number of bushes and the extent of trimming needed. Regular pruning helps maintain the desired shape and health of azaleas.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

How often should azaleas be pruned? The frequency of pruning depends on the growth and health of the azalea, but typically, it is recommended to prune once after flowering to maintain shape and promote healthy growth.
What is the best time to prune azaleas? The ideal time to prune azaleas is immediately after they finish blooming, usually in late spring or early summer, to encourage new growth for the next season.
Can azaleas be over-pruned? Yes, over-pruning can harm azaleas by reducing flowering and overall health. It's important to prune selectively and avoid removing more than one-third of the plant at a time.
What tools are recommended for pruning azaleas? Sharp pruning shears or loppers are recommended for clean cuts, helping to minimize damage and promote quick healing.
